Indian Air Force AFCAT 02/2026 Recruitment 2026 Age Limit
(Age calculated as on 01 July 2027)
| Branch | Age Limit |
|---|---|
| Flying Branch (AFCAT & NCC Entry) | 20 to 24 years (born 02 July 2003 – 01 July 2007) |
| Flying Branch (with valid DGCA CPL) | Relaxation up to 26 years |
| Ground Duty Technical & Non-Technical | 20 to 26 years (born 02 July 2001 – 01 July 2007) |
Note: Candidates must be unmarried at the time of course commencement. Marriage during training is not permitted, and violations attract discharge and cost recovery.

Indian Air Force AFCAT Selection Process
The AFCAT 02/2026 Recruitment follows a multi-stage selection process:
- Stage 1 – AFCAT Written Examination: Online computer-based test of 2 hours, 100 objective-type questions (3 marks each, –1 for wrong answers). Subjects: General Awareness, English, Numerical Ability, Reasoning & Military Aptitude.
- Stage 2 – AFSB Testing (Stage 1): Officer Intelligence Rating (OIR) Test, Picture Perception & Discussion Test (PPDT). Candidates not clearing Stage 1 are eliminated.
- Stage 3 – AFSB Testing (Stage 2): Psychological Tests, Group Tasks, and Personal Interview conducted over 5 days at residential selection boards (Dehradun, Mysuru, Gandhinagar, or Varanasi).
- Stage 4 – CPSS Test: Mandatory only for Flying Branch applicants. Computerized Pilot Selection System (CPSS) test assesses pilot aptitude.
- Stage 5 – Medical Examination: Final medical fitness check for all selected candidates.
Special Entries:
- NCC Special Entry (Flying Branch): No written exam required. Direct AFSB call for candidates with NCC ‘C’ Certificate (Air Wing).
- GATE Score Entry (Ground Duty Technical): Valid GATE score in approved engineering disciplines replaces the AFCAT written exam.
- Candidates eligible for multiple entries must register separately for each.

Indian Air Force AFCAT 02/2026 Education Qualification
Flying Branch (AFCAT & NCC Special Entry):
- Passed 10+2 with minimum 50% marks each in Physics and Mathematics AND
- Graduation (minimum 3-year degree) from a recognised university with at least 60% marks, OR
- BE/B.Tech degree (4-year course) from a recognised university with minimum 60% marks, OR
- Cleared Section A & B of Associate Membership of Institution of Engineers (India) or Aeronautical Society of India with minimum 60% marks
Ground Duty (Technical) – Aeronautical Engineering [Electronics & Mechanical]:
- Minimum 60% marks in Physics and Mathematics at 10+2 level AND
- Graduation/Post-Graduation degree in Engineering/Technology from a recognised university
Ground Duty (Non-Technical):
- Graduation in any discipline from a recognised university with minimum 60% marks
For GATE Score Entry: Valid GATE score in applicable engineering disciplines is required as per official notification.
